Output f740693e5314bbde0a1c544b9f0fc9d894e9d1969fb920646177f459c32eb709:0

value
438071862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9c88aa44ac27b9c44c3a9a9867d640018fe434 OP_EQUALVERIFY OP_CHECKSIG
address
1DdumdqFwWpYrFXvYbwcR8xdF51wNZjLjV
transaction
f740693e5314bbde0a1c544b9f0fc9d894e9d1969fb920646177f459c32eb709
spent
true